JEE Main 2023 Correction Dates​


The link to edit information in the application form of JEE Main 2023 (session 2) has been activated from 13th March 2023. Correction in the application for 2nd session can be done till 14th March 2023 (9 pm). After this period no correction in the particulars is entertained by the NTA authority under any circumstances.

For Session 1, correction window was available from 13th January to 14th January 2023. Candidates must note that correction can be done only in few editable details before the last date of correction.

Important Points for Correction:​

  • All the parameters (Except name of candidate, contact/ address details, category, PwD status, educational qualification details, date of birth, choice of exam cities, etc.) in Application Form can be editable.
  • Correction in Application Form Particulars may be allowed only once.
  • After correction in the Application Form particulars, mentioned change(s) can be updated immediately if additional Examination Fee can not be required based on the changes in particulars.
  • In case additional Examination Fee will required to pay based on the changes in Application Form particulars, then final updation of correction(s) in Application Form Particulars will be done only after the successfully payment of additional amount of Examination Fee.
  • The additional amount of Examination Fee (if applicable) will be submitted by SBI MOPS (Net Banking/ Debit/ Credit Card).

JEE Main Correction Fee Payment​


The balance fee, if any due to correction in particulars, have to be paid by the candidates during that period. In case of fee payment, any changes done in the application will be updated after the successful payment.

Note: The additional amount (if applicable) should be paid by the candidates through Net Banking/ Debit card/ Credit Card/ PAYTM/ UPI during the correction period. Since, it is the one-time facility, extended to the candidates to avoid any hardship to them; therefore, the candidates are informed to do the correction very carefully because no further chance of correction will be given to the candidates for whatsoever reason.

How to Edit JEE Main 2023 Application Form​


The candidates should follow the following steps for JEE Main Correction 2023 in application form:

  • Go to the website. (link is given above)
  • Log in with your application number and password.
  • After login, the details filled in the form are displayed.
  • At the end of the page, a link with ‘Edit Application Form’ is displayed.
  • Go through the form carefully.
  • Once you finish editing check and recheck all the details.
  • Submit only when you are satisfied that form is now correctly filled.
  • When the form is submitted after correction, take a print out of JEE Main 2023 application form correction slip and keep it safe.
